PSE 15 Won't Open .CR3 Files

I have Windows 10 and PSE 15. I just shot some RAW files with the Canon extension .CR3. I try to open in RAW in PSE, but they won't open. I checked for updates, but my software indicates everything is up to date. How can I open Canon .CR3 files so I can edit them... or even look at them with this software? Thanks!

You don't state the only necessary information: which is your Canon camera type? If the camera was issued after the release of PSE15, obviously its raw format can't be recognized.

The CR3 - RAW format is relatively new. At the moment only the .CR3 file from the Canon M50 was supported. For other cameras Adobe has to develop the support in the appropriate applications. You have to wait until Adobe released the updates. In the meantime you must you the Canon DPP utility.

BTW: I don't know if  PSE 15 is still supported. If not you have to buy an update to the newest PSE version. Or you convert the .CR3 files into the DNG format using Adobe DNG Converter. Then you can use this files in PSE 15.
